Palamida Invited to Participate in Microsoft and Novell Linux Announcement.


SAN FRANCISCO -- Palamida[TM], a provider of software intellectual property (IP) management and compliance products and services, today announced its participation in the Microsoft and Novell Linux announcement.

Background

Microsoft and Novell today announced a new agreement supporting broad collaboration on Windows and Linux interoperability and support. As part of the agreement, the two companies will provide each other's customers with patent coverage for their respective products.

About Palamida

Palamida answers the question "What's in your code?" by providing an unprecedented level of software transparency. By empowering customers with insightful information about their software assets, Palamida products and services offer accurate evaluations of software during acquisitions, on-going testing against intellectual property policy during application development and governance of software environments.
